The Business Relationship Management team serves as the bridge between the technology organization and TriNet business leaders. The Business Analyst position is a core member of the BRM team and is the intersection between business and engineering colleagues throughout the software development lifecycle. Business Analysts work to fully understand the business needs and objectives of a technology initiative, translating this understanding into tangible, documented user stories. This role collaborates with stakeholders to gather business requirements, documents business processes, and identifies improvements to enhance operational efficiency. This position holds foundational knowledge of core business processes and ensures business requirements are successfully implemented into technology solutions. This position is also highly engaged in addressing clarification questions from Engineering while aligning with business colleagues to ensure applications are designed to match requirements from the business units. The Senior Business Analyst brings Business Analyst best practices to the BRM team. This role works with business leaders to ensure clarity on their business objectives while challenging assumptions. The Senior Business Analyst leads multiple initiatives simultaneously and collaborates across TriNet business units to bring a holistic view of organizational priorities, goals, needs, and challenges. This position ensures that organizational priorities and outcomes are clearly defined for each initiative, relying on data, metrics, and business relationships to develop accurate and complete use cases.
